Job description

P.B. Brown is seeking an experienced Construction Superintendent with an active Massachusetts Construction Supervisor License (CSL) to oversee and manage the building of a self-storage project in Roxbury, MA. This project is due to start in September 2026. Must have experience managing ground-up commercial construction. Procore Management software experience is required.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

Provide overall on-site supervisory and technical management on the construction project site. Ensure client satisfaction is maintained. High level of control in planning and coordinating field activities. Works closely with the Project Manager, often during the planning and buyout of the project.

  • Supervise total construction effort to ensure the project is constructed by design, budget, and schedule. Includes interfacing with client representatives, A-E representatives, other contractors, etc.
  • Administer on-site safety program
  • Plan, coordinate, and supervise on-site functions and staff (engineering, material control, etc.)
  • Develop and manage project schedules using Outbuild/Procore/MS Project.
  • Schedule and coordinate subcontractors and ensure overall contractual performance.
  • Approve all project purchase requisitions, equipment rentals, etc.
  • Provide technical assistance, i.e., interpretation of drawings, recommending construction methods and equipment, etc.
  • Implement and maintain tight quality control issues.
  • Assist project management in developing and implementing project procedures, management tools, standards, etc.
  • Review submittals for compliance with contract requirements.
  • Ensure all on-site personnel comply with project procedures, work rules, etc. Document all violations, notify project management, and recommend/implement corrective actions as required.
  • Review change order requests before submittal to owners.
  • Perform additional assignments per the Supervisor’s direction.

QUALIFICATIONS

  • Active Massachusetts Construction Supervisor License (CSL) required
  • OSHA 30 Certification required
  • 8+ years of experience as a Construction Superintendent (commercial experience preferred)
  • Strong knowledge of construction methods, scheduling, and safety regulations
  • Ability to read and interpret blueprints and technical documents
  • Experience managing multiple subcontractors and trades
  • Proficiency with Procore construction management software
  • Strong leadership, communication, and problem-solving skills
  • Specialization in project sizes from $1 million to $15 million is a plus.
